WebApr 1, 2024 · Shoaib Akhtar bowled the fastest ball in the history of cricket at 161.3 km/h (100.23 mph). He did it against England on 22 February 2003 in a World Cup match at Newlands, Cape Town, South Africa. Web8.1K 577K views 4 years ago Top 10 fastest balls recorded in cricket history. Shoaib Akhtar, also known as the ‘Rawalpindi Express,’ is the fastest bowler in cricket history, having bowled the fastest ball ever recorded at 161.3 km/h (100.23 mph) during the 2003 ICC World Cup. He was known for his blistering pace and the ability to intimidate even the best batsmen. gingers with mullets 2020
